Frequently asked questions

How accurate are these YouTube video analytics?

View, like, and comment counts come from YouTube's public API and refresh regularly. Growth and revenue figures are estimates built from tracked historical data, so they can differ slightly from what the creator sees privately in YouTube Studio.

What is the outlier score?

How this video's views compare to the channel's usual Shorts or long-form video. A 2x score means double the usual views for that channel, 0.5x means half.

What is engagement rate and how is it calculated?

Likes and comments per view, compared to this channel's typical engagement rate — shown as above or below what's usual for the channel.

How is the revenue estimate calculated?

It's a rough public estimate based on a $0.7–$2.0 CPM (revenue per 1,000 views) applied to view count — not actual creator earnings, which depend on ad rates, audience geography, and monetization settings YouTube doesn't expose publicly.
